Joao has extensive conversations with friends, strangers and himself. For instance with his best friend Irene, who cannot let go of memories of her ex; and the boy he meets in the metro, with whom he wants to have sex. Beside life and love, the creative process is a recurring theme in the conversations, in the best traditions of filmmakers like Éric Rohmer or Hong Sang-soo. Piece by piece, the encounters, conversations and monologues have a great influence on Joao, who literally wrestles with his attitude to life. A puzzle unfolds within which time, narrative, character and perspective are all jumbled up in an intriguing way. (International Film Festival Rotterdam)
